27 Westview Close, Peacehaven, BN10 8GA is a leasehold flat built in 2007 onwards. The property offers approximately 609 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£243,810 , which equates to approximately £397 per square foot. It was last sold on 9 May 2014 for £179,000. Since then, the value has increased by £64,810, representing a 36.2% increase, or approximately 3.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£243,810 is:

  • 13.9% lower than the average property price on Westview Close
  • 14.0% lower than the average in the BN10 8GA postcode area
  • and 28.8% lower than the average price for Peacehaven as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 13 January 2012,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

27 Westview Close, Peacehaven, Lewes, East Sussex, BN10 8GA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 13 Jan 2012.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 6 May 2010, when the property was rated B. The current rating of C re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 6%.
